Fedora 25 הוא עכשיו החוצה. אנשים מזמזם, כמו הצוות החליטו לעשות Wayland ברירת המחדל הפגישה הגרפית הולך קדימה. עבור משתמשי לינוקס רבים Wayland הוא מונח חדש כי יש צץ, אבל אחד שהם לא מבינים.

במאמר זה נלך בקצרה על מה ויילנד הוא, מה היא עושה, ולמה מפתחים נוהרים אליו בהמוניהם! מה בדיוק ויילנד? בוא נגלה!

למה ויילנד?

כל עוד שולחן העבודה של לינוקס היה דבר, היה שרת תצוגה. טכנולוגיה זו ידועה בשם X11 והיא מה עובד עם כרטיס המסך במחשב לינוקס שלך כדי לגרום גרפיקה לקרות. שרת התצוגה הוא מה שמאפשר סביבות שולחן עבודה, תוכניות ואפילו משחקים.

כל הפצה לינוקס משתמש בשרת התצוגה X11, קבוצה של כלים כי הוא בערך כמו ההתחלה של לינוקס (אולי אפילו יותר). מבלי לקבל טכני מדי, זה בטוח לומר כי שרת התצוגה X11 יש טונות של בעיות, ואת הקונצנזוס הכללי בקהילת לינוקס היא כי יש לנו outgrown את הטכנולוגיה הזו, וזה חלק ממה שמחזיק לינוקס בחזרה כפלטפורמה.

שיחות החלו על שרת תצוגה חדש עבור לינוקס, מודרני אחד כי אין חורים אבטחה בולטת כי יש מנוגע X11 לאורך השנים ואין בעיות טכניות מעצבן שלה גם. זה שרת התצוגה החדש הוא Wayland.

מה עושה Wayland?

Wayland הוא פרוטוקול התצוגה, וגם אחד מאובטח בזה. כל יישום יחיד הוא "לקוח", וחומרת הווידאו שלך היא "שרת". בניגוד ל- X11, כל תוכנית תוכל להשתמש בפרוטוקול Wayland בכוחות עצמה. משמעות הדבר היא ביצועים טובים יותר, כמו שרת התצוגה אינו עובד קשה כדי לשמור על בלגן אחד גדול במקום רק מאפשר לצייר לצייר כי צריך את זה.

יחד עם כל זה, פרוטוקול Wayland יש משהו שנקרא XWayland. זהו כלי המאפשר להביא תוכניות מבוססות X11 לקפל. משמעות הדבר היא כי ברגע שרת התצוגה החדש מוכן, תוכניות פופולריות ימשיכו לעבוד כרגיל.

הפרוטוקול הוא גם מעולה כשמדובר אבטחה. עם X11, אפשר לעשות משהו המכונה "keylogging" בכך שהוא מאפשר לכל תוכנית להתקיים ברקע ולקרוא מה קורה עם חלונות אחרים פתוחים באזור X11. עם Wayland זה פשוט לא יקרה (אם כי זה כנראה לא בלתי אפשרי), כמו כל תוכנית פועלת באופן עצמאי.

זה אפשרי עבור תוכניות אחרות להקשיב ולגנוב מידע הוא גדול עבור אבטחה, אבל זה גם יכול לזרוק מפתח ברגים. דברים פשוטים כמו "להעתיק ולהדביק" כבר המציאו מחדש בגלל זה!

אילו מנהלי התקנים תומכים כיום ב- Wayland

נכון לעכשיו, אלה המבקשים לנסות את Wayland יהיה צורך להפעיל את קוד פתוח Nvidia הנהג או את קוד פתוח Intel הנהג. נווידיה / AMD נהגים לא עובדים עם ויילנד, וזה לא סביר לשנות עד החברות להוסיף תמיכה (אם כי ההנחה שזה יקרה בקרוב מאוד).

כיצד לנסות את Wayland

רוב הפצות לינוקס החליטו ללכת עם Wayland (למעט אובונטו). הדרך המהירה, חסרת הכאב ביותר לנסות את זה כרגע היא להוריד את Fedora 25 ולהתקין אותה. אין צורך בהגדרה, והוא מוגדר כברירת המחדל.

עם זאת, אם אתה על לינוקס אחר distro, דרך טובה לנסות את Wayland היא להתקין את Gnome Shell או KDE פלזמה 5. שני הפרויקטים כבר עובד קשה על יישום מפגש נהדר Wayland. ניתן למצוא את הפעלות אלה במנהל הכניסה.

סיכום

X11 הוא איטי טלאים של קוד על קוד מקשה על זה עושה את זה קשה כדי לחדש. מה שחמור הוא שיש רק קבוצה קטנה של מפתחי X11 שאפילו מבינים את הטכנולוגיה. זה בגלל זה כי X11 יש לאט לאט gotten גרוע ככל השנים עברו.

זו הסיבה שבגללה קהילת לינוקס בחרה לנוע לכיוון ויילנד. זה מודרני, קל יותר עבור קוד, וכן יעזור להפוך את הצגת גרפיקה על מערכות לינוקס יותר מודרני.

מה דעתך על Wayland? ספר לנו למטה!

אשראי תמונה: wayland.org, linux-ink.ru